Five Components of Health-Related Fitness - CORRECT ANSWER 1. Muscular strength
- the amount of force a muscle can apply in a given contraction. Lifting weights is an example of
exercise that can cause the muscle to grow in response to the extra work and increase muscle
strength.


2. Muscular endurance - ability of muscles to keep working over a period of time.


3. Cardiorespiratory endurance - ability of heart, blood vessels, lungs, and blood to deliver
oxygen and nutrients to all of the body's cells while being physically active. As your
cardiorespiratory endurance improves, your heart beats stronger and slower. (It does not have to
beat as fast since it can now pump more blood out with each beat.)
Cardiorespiratory endurance is the most important component of health-related fitness. Aerobic
exercise is the type of exercise that will improve cardiorespiratory endurance.
Resting heart rate (RHR) - the number of times the heart beats per minute while at rest, and
recovery time - amount of time it takes for the heart to return to RHR after strenuous activity, are
good indicators of one's level of cardiorespiratory endurance. The quicker you recover and the
lower your RHR, the better your cardiorespiratory endurance is.


4. Flexibility - ability of joints to move through their full range of motion. Good flexibility keeps
joint movements smooth and efficient. Lack of use can cause joints to become stiffer as you get
older.
Any activity that involves a joint moving through a full range of motion will help maintain
flexibility.


5. Body Composition - the ratio of lean body tissue (muscle and bone) to body fat tissue. A
healthy body has a high proportion of lean body tissue compared to body fat tissue. Too much

, body fat increases of developing certain lifestyle diseases like diabetes and cardiovascular
disease.

aerobic vs anaerobic - CORRECT ANSWER Weight training is considered to be an
anaerobic activity. During anaerobic activity, muscle cells produce energy without using oxygen.
Anaerobic activity is intense and short in duration.


Skill-related fitness describes 6 components of fitness that are important for good athletic
performance. The 6 components are: - CORRECT ANSWER coordination, balance,
agility, power, speed, and reaction time.

Physical activity should continue - CORRECT ANSWER as a lifelong habit to reduce risk
of health problems. Frequent strength training and a healthy diet may help prevent osteoporosis
(bone thinning disease), maintain bone density, muscle tone, strength, endurance, and flexibility
and affect your overall health for the rest of your life.


Exercise is part of treatment plans for - CORRECT ANSWER diabetes, asthma, mental
and physical disabilities.
People who experience exercise induced asthma often do not want to take part in physical
activity, but exercise is part of the treatment plan for people with asthma. Gaining fitness helps
decrease the severity of asthma symptoms.
Exercise is also very important for people who have diabetes as it helps to control blood sugar
levels and weight problems associated with diabetes.
